What about using over-the-counter and herbal products to lower my cholesterol? Do they really work?

Frequently Asked Cardiac Questions - Dr Barry J Bellovin MD ...
Sometimes. Many preparations (including Metamucil) contain soluble fiber, which can lower cholesterol up to 10%. Garlic products can help, but usually not by very much. Niacin is very effective, but only in very high doses (usually more than 1000 mg per day). In those doses, it tends to have more side effects than prescription drugs. Of course, no drug, prescription or herbal, is a substitute for a proper diet!

How does soy protein lower cholesterol?

WestSoy: FAQ's
Soy protein improves liver metabolism, which helps increase the removal of LDL from the bloodstream. It can also decrease the absorption of cholesterol in the gut. See similar questions...

Why should we lower cholesterol in our diet?

Dreamfields Pasta, Healthy nutrition frequently asked questi...
Cholesterol in the body comes from two sources - most of it is made by the liver from various nutrients and especially from saturated fats and the rest of it comes directly from eating animal products such as meats, egg yolks, organ meats, whole milk and milk products. Scientific research has shown that a diet high in saturated fat seems to increase cholesterol production in the body. See similar questions...

How can I lower my cholesterol level?

WestSoy: FAQ's
The FDA has determined that a diet low in saturated fat and cholesterol and high in soy protein can lower cholesterol levels and reduce the risk of heart disease. Soy protein has been found to lower low-density lipoproteins (LDL) with no change or an increase in the levels of high-density lipoproteins (HDL). LDLs have been shown to increase the risk of cardiovascular disease, while HDLs have been found to decrease the risk of cardiovascular disease. See similar questions...

Should a person avoid dairy products to lower cholesterol?

Frequently Asked Questions
Skim milk and low-fat dairy products contain only small amounts of saturated fat and cholesterol and can easily be included in a low-fat, low-cholesterol eating plan. In addition, dairy products are excellent sources of calcium, a mineral that may help prevent the development of osteoporosis, or brittle bones, later in life. See similar questions...

Can regular workouts lower our cholesterol level?

Asian Bariatrics - Online Obesity Advocacy
Your total cholesterol score is composed of LDL (or "bad" cholesterol) and HDL (or "good" cholesterol). Exercise doesn't seem to affect the bad cholesterol (eating less saturated fat does) but it increases the good cholesterol. When you exercise and eat less saturated fat (these are fats from animal sources), your total cholesterol is usually lowered and the ratio should change for the better -- less bad cholesterol and more good cholesterol. Is Lipitor safe to use to lower cholesterol?

LipitorDiscount.com -> Lipitor Faq's
Lipitor is generally well tolerated. Like all medicines, Lipitor may cause side effects in some people. If you are prescribed Lipitor, be sure to alert your doctor as soon as possible if you have any unexplained muscle pain, tenderness or weakness. The side effects reported most often are gas, stomach pain, indigestion and constipation. These side effects are usually mild and tend to go away. See similar questions...
